# Provenance: replica-lag alarm (Tidepool DB)

Quick note for the sync: the new read-replica lag alarm in Tidepool is now built from the signed pipeline, not Renna's laptop (progress!). Thresholds live in the alarm manifest, which is hashed into the artifact, so if staging and prod disagree, diff the manifests first. The alarm deploys from the Quillbase registry only. Current deployed artifact traces back to the build stamped below.

session token of tajef-bageg = htk21_5d90d574934f3ccae6437

Welcome to the Lumenquill release track. Before tagging a release, verify feature parity between the Kotlin and Swift SDKs using the parity matrix in the Driftboard workspace. Any method present in one SDK but not the other must be flagged and either implemented or documented as a deliberate gap. The parity checker job runs nightly against the staging schema, so both SDK test suites query the same records. It authenticates to staging with the connection string below.

replica DSN, tawef-hahap: mysql://eliix_svc:FiIC0jz@db-394a.lumiclabs.internal:5432/holius

**Ticket PARITY-412: Kestrel SDK catch-up**

Quick one for the weekly sync: the Kestrel-Go SDK is still missing batched uploads and retry hints that Kestrel-JS shipped two releases ago. Partner teams keep asking. Plan is to land both behind a flag this sprint and cut a minor release. Needs a sign-off from the owner named below.

account owner for bajef-badup: Drueth Kelath Pelael Holwyn

Ticket: Drift in dependency pins — Corvette build image

The Corvette CI image has drifted from the pinning policy: three libraries float on minor versions, contradicting our exact-pin rule adopted last quarter. This caused an unreproducible build on Tuesday. For future maintainers, the policy is documented in the build handbook. The image should be rebuilt with the pins below:

service settings:
quenath:
  log_level: info
  metrics_host: metrics.quenath.tolvaqlabs.internal
  pin: 1407
  pool_size: 8